About Simon-Kucher
Simon-Kucher is a global consultancy with more than 2,000 employees in 30+ countries.Our sole focus is on unlocking better growth that drives measurable revenue and profit for our clients.We achieve this by optimizing every lever of their commercial strategy – product, price, innovation, marketing, and sales – based on deep insights into what customers want and value. With 40 years of experience in monetization topics of all kinds, we are regarded as the world’s leading pricing and growth specialist.
